Announcement

Collapse
No announcement yet.

Optimisation script d'install

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• YodaNC
    replied
    ca devrait etre bon sur le svn

    Leave a comment:


  • WAtt
    replied
    Oups, j'ai été un peu vite et pas relu .... ops:

    Merci d'avoir corrigé

    WAtt

    Leave a comment:


  • DonKiShoot
    replied
    Originally posted by WAtt
    Rhooooo que vois-je...

    Ligne 290.
    Code:
    mkdir $INSTALL_DIR_OREON >> $LOG_FILE 2>> $LOG_FILE
    a remplacer par:
    Code:
    mkdir $INSTALL_DIR_OREON 2>&1 >> ${LOG_FILE}
    Bon je continu mon investigation 8)

    Watt[/code]
    Je dirais même plus :
    Code:
    mkdir $INSTALL_DIR_OREON >> ${LOG_FILE} 2>&1
    cf : http://www.spi.ens.fr/~beig/systeme/shell.html

    Code:
    #  process 2>&1  concatène la sortie d'erreur à la sortie standard. Exemple:
    	commande >file 2>&1	# bon
    	commande 2>&1 >file	# mauvais

    Leave a comment:


  • WAtt
    replied
    Rhooooo que vois-je...

    Ligne 290.
    Code:
    mkdir $INSTALL_DIR_OREON >> $LOG_FILE 2>> $LOG_FILE
    a remplacer par:
    Code:
    mkdir $INSTALL_DIR_OREON 2>&1 >> ${LOG_FILE}
    Bon je continu mon investigation 8)

    Watt[/code]

    Leave a comment:


  • WAtt
    started a topic Optimisation script d'install

    Optimisation script d'install

    Bonjour à tous...

    Je profite d'avoir un peu de temps pour taffer un peu sur Oreon

    Pour le moment je ne suis que sur le script d'install.. Bon je sens que je vais me faire huer, mais bon c'est un détails. La correction aussi est un détail puisque c'est uniquement pour ne pas s'emmerder lorsque l'on code..

    Code actuel:
    Code:
    echo
    echo "###############################################################################"
    echo "#                    OREON Project (www.oreon-project.org)                    #"
    echo "#                            Thanks for using OREON                           #"
    echo "#                                                                             #"
    echo "#                                    v 1.3                                    #"
    echo "#                                                                             #"
    echo "#                             [email protected]                         #"
    echo "#                                                                             #"
    echo "#                     Make sure you have installed and configured             #"
    echo "#                                   sudo - sed                                #"
    echo "#                          php - apache - rrdtool - mysql                     #"
    echo "#                                                                             #"
    echo "#                                                                             #"
    echo "###############################################################################"
    echo "#                                 The Team OREON                              #"
    echo "###############################################################################"
    echo ""
    echo ""
    Peut-être ecris plus rapidement avec :
    Code:
    cat << EOF
    
    ###############################################################################
    #                    OREON Project (www.oreon-project.org)                    #
    #                            Thanks for using OREON                           #
    #                                                                             #
    #                                    v 1.3                                    #
    #                                                                             #
    #                             [email protected]                         #
    #                                                                             #
    #                     Make sure you have installed and configured             #
    #                                   sudo - sed                                #
    #                          php - apache - rrdtool - mysql                     #
    #                                                                             #
    #                                                                             #
    ###############################################################################
    #                                 The Team OREON                              #
    ###############################################################################
    EOF
    Idem pour ceci:
    Code:
    echo "##" >> $DIR_APACHE_CONF/oreon.conf
             echo "## Section add by OREON Install Setup" >> $DIR_APACHE_CONF/oreon.conf
             echo "##" >> $DIR_APACHE_CONF/oreon.conf
             echo "" >> $DIR_APACHE_CONF/oreon.conf
             echo "AddType application/x-java-jnlp-file .jnlp" >> $DIR_APACHE_CONF/oreon.conf
             echo "Alias /oreon/ $INSTALL_DIR_OREON/www/" >> $DIR_APACHE_CONF/oreon.conf
             echo "<Directory "$INSTALL_DIR_OREON/www">" >> $DIR_APACHE_CONF/oreon.conf
             echo "    Options None" >> $DIR_APACHE_CONF/oreon.conf
             echo "    AllowOverride AuthConfig Options" >> $DIR_APACHE_CONF/oreon.conf
             echo "    Order allow,deny" >> $DIR_APACHE_CONF/oreon.conf
             echo "    Allow from all" >> $DIR_APACHE_CONF/oreon.conf
             echo "</Directory>" >> $DIR_APACHE_CONF/oreon.conf
             echo "" >> $DIR_APACHE_CONF/oreon.conf
    On applique le même principe:
    Code:
    cat << EOF >> $DIR_APACHE_CONF/oreon.conf
    ##
    ## Section add by OREON Install Setup
    ##
    
    AddType application/x-java-jnlp-file .jnlp
    Alias /oreon/ $INSTALL_DIR_OREON/www/
    <Directory "$INSTALL_DIR_OREON/www">
        Options None
        AllowOverride AuthConfig Options
        Order allow,deny
        Allow from all
    </Directory>
    
    EOF
    Bon je sais.. pourquoi ca.. bah pour gagner 3 minutes dans l'ecriture du script, ca fait 3 minutes de plus au café :lol:

    Bonne soirée à tous

    WAtt
Working...
X